Course details
Artificial Intelligence (AI) Fundamentals for Transportation: This unit covers the basics of AI, including machine learning, deep learning, and natural language processing, as well as their applications in the transportation sector. •
Data Analytics for AI-Driven Transportation Systems: This unit focuses on data collection, analysis, and interpretation to inform AI-driven transportation decisions, including data visualization and predictive modeling. •
AI in Autonomous Vehicles: This unit explores the use of AI in autonomous vehicles, including computer vision, sensor fusion, and decision-making algorithms, as well as regulatory frameworks for autonomous vehicles. •
AI Strategy for Smart Cities: This unit examines the role of AI in creating smart cities, including intelligent transportation systems, smart energy management, and public safety applications. •
Machine Learning for Transportation Optimization: This unit applies machine learning techniques to optimize transportation systems, including route planning, traffic prediction, and logistics management. •
Natural Language Processing for Transportation Applications: This unit covers the use of NLP in transportation, including chatbots, voice assistants, and text analysis for transportation data. •
AI Ethics and Governance in Transportation: This unit discusses the ethical considerations and governance frameworks for AI in transportation, including bias, transparency, and accountability. •
AI-Driven Transportation Security: This unit explores the use of AI in transportation security, including threat detection, incident response, and passenger screening. •
AI in Supply Chain Management for Transportation: This unit applies AI to supply chain management in transportation, including demand forecasting, inventory management, and freight optimization. •
AI Strategy for Transportation Industry Disruption: This unit examines the impact of AI on the transportation industry, including disruption, innovation, and future trends.

AI Strategy in Transportation: Job Market Trends
Key Roles and Statistics
| Data Scientist | Design and implement AI models to optimize transportation systems, analyze data to identify trends and patterns, and communicate insights to stakeholders. |
| Machine Learning Engineer | Develop and deploy machine learning models to improve transportation efficiency, safety, and sustainability, and collaborate with cross-functional teams to integrate AI solutions. |
| Business Analyst | Conduct market research and analysis to identify opportunities for AI adoption in transportation, develop business cases for AI projects, and collaborate with stakeholders to implement AI solutions. |
| Transportation Manager | Oversee the implementation of AI solutions in transportation systems, manage budgets and resources, and ensure compliance with regulatory requirements. |
